Hi there!

I am in the process of getting my Bach Degree in Education (Elementary) and just curious what other people think about the demand (if there is any) for teachers in general in Oklahoma? Does anyone think with all the layoffs, state of the economy, budget cuts, etc., that it's even worth going into Education at this point? I continue to want and hope that I can complete/finish my degree within the next 2 years but the the way everyone is talking- --it's a bad deal to be going into this field. However, I feel like everything is bound to turn around sooner or later and I should just stick with my current plan and plan on completing my degree. Anyone have any thoughts on this suject, I would appreciate hearing it...
